The Mexico lung cancer diagnostics market is experiencing growth driven by increasing incidences of lung cancer in the country. The market is characterized by the presence of various diagnostic tools such as imaging tests (X-rays, CT scans), biopsy, blood tests, and molecular testing. The demand for advanced diagnostic technologies like liquid biopsy and next-generation sequencing is also on the rise. The market is witnessing a shift towards early detection and personalized treatment approaches, driving the adoption of precision medicine in lung cancer diagnostics. Key players in the market include Roche, Thermo Fisher Scientific, Qiagen, and Illumina. Government initiatives to improve cancer screening programs and access to healthcare services are expected to further propel the market growth in Mexico.

In the Mexico lung cancer diagnostics market, several challenges are faced, including limited access to advanced diagnostic technologies in certain regions, leading to delayed or inaccurate diagnoses. Additionally, there is a shortage of skilled healthcare professionals trained in interpreting diagnostic tests, which can affect the quality of patient care. Furthermore, the high cost of diagnostic procedures and treatments can be a barrier for many patients, especially in a country where access to affordable healthcare is a concern. The lack of comprehensive screening programs and awareness campaigns for early detection of lung cancer also contributes to late-stage diagnoses and poorer treatment outcomes. Overall, addressing these challenges through improved infrastructure, training programs, and public health initiatives is crucial for enhancing the effectiveness of lung cancer diagnostics in Mexico.

The Mexico government has implemented various policies to address lung cancer diagnostics, focusing on early detection and treatment. Public health programs such as the National Cancer Institute (INCan) offer screening services for high-risk individuals, including smokers and those with a family history of lung cancer. Additionally, the government has prioritized the development of guidelines for healthcare providers to improve the accuracy and efficiency of diagnostic tests, such as CT scans and biopsies. Policies also emphasize the importance of access to affordable and quality healthcare services for all citizens, leading to increased funding for cancer research and treatment facilities. Overall, the government`s efforts aim to enhance early detection rates, improve patient outcomes, and reduce the burden of lung cancer in Mexico.
